Dreischor, located in the southwest of the Netherlands in the province of Zeeland, lies on the island of Schouwen-Duiveland where ring-shaped village streets surround a historic churchyard mound, and starting a holiday in Dreischor is simple thanks to the N57 and N654 that connect the area with Brouwershaven, Zierikzee and the broader island routes. The gently rising landscape around the former peat soils offers walkers alternating views of ditches, orchards and the characteristic circular layout, while quiet rural lanes reveal places where a holiday home in Dreischor becomes a natural base for exploring its agricultural surroundings. A villa in Dreischor provides access to open fields bordered by reed-lined waterways, and the presence of the Dreischor Vroon adds a steady water element noticeable during early-morning walks along the grassed edges. Cyclists rely on the numbered junction network linking the wine estate, surrounding hamlets and scenic polder roads, and a B&B in Dreischor suits guests who appreciate short distances to heritage farms, nature reserves and quiet inland paths. Families visit the local vineyard, anglers make use of the calm drainage canals, and day hikers enjoy routes leading to the old dike system. This combination gives Dreischor a quiet rural rhythm that reveals itself gradually.
